Legal Requirements & Penalties in AK

Alaska law requires workers' compensation coverage for employers with one or more employees. Failure to comply can result in fines up to $1,000 per day and potential criminal charges. The system is no-fault, providing benefits for work-related injuries regardless of fault.

Claims Process: Step-by-Step

  1. Report the injury within 30 days
  2. Submit the Employer's Report of Injury or Illness
  3. Include wage statement and medical reports
  4. Start benefits if claim is approved

Industry Risk Factors & Class Codes

Premiums are based on classification codes assigned to job roles. High-risk industries like fishing pay more than low-risk ones like office work. Keeping accurate records helps reduce costs.
